How to Master the Art of Sunrise Watching
- Set an Alarm: This might sound obvious, but trust us, it's easy to hit snooze when it's still dark outside.
- Find the Perfect Spot: Look for a place with a clear view of the eastern horizon. Bonus points if it's quiet and peaceful.
- Be Patient: The magic happens gradually, so take your time and enjoy the process.
- Bring a Friend (or a Pet): Sunrise is better shared.
- Capture the Moment: Photos or videos can help you relive the experience.
